Obstructive Sleep Apnea is a Cardiovascular Risk Factor in Stroke Patients

Posted by john  

Study suggests patients with obstructive sleep apnea and a former stroke victim has a higher rate of death. Out of 132 patients enrolled, only 116 survived over a ten year follow up. The risk of death was higher among the 23 patients with obstructive sleep apnea. The conclusions suggest that patients with stroke and obstructive sleep apnea have increased risk in an early death.

Source: Arch Intern Med
